Impulse. Impulse is a vector because force has a direction, and the units are the same as momentum(N*s).. Here are some key things to know about impulse:. Impulse is the product of force and time, represented mathematically as J = F*ฮ”t.. By convention, if work is done on the system it is considered to be positive work and will result in the total energy of the system increasing. Work done by the system is negative work and will remove energy from the system.. Power. Power is the rate at which Work is done on or by an object. At an AP Physics 1 level, the energy of a simple harmonic oscillator (SHO) can be understood as the sum of kinetic and potential energy. The kinetic energy of an SHO is the energy an object possesses due to its motion and is equal to. 1/2mv^2. , where m is the mass of the object and v is its velocity.
